DataFlow CSV Import / Export
3.0.4
forked from
Disclaimer
Description
Ever found yourself drowning in a sea of spreadsheets, desperately trying to wrangle that unruly CSV data into your site? Fear not, fellow developers, agencies, and open-source aficionados! We’ve all been there, staring blankly at endless rows and columns, wondering if there’s a better way. Well, guess what? There is! Introducing DataFlow CSV Import / Export, the tool that’s about to become your new best friend. This isn’t just another plugin; it’s a lifesaver, a sanity preserver, and maybe even a marriage counselor for you and your data. Forged from the fires of the original AIT CSV Import / Export (hats off to AitThemes.Club for the initial spark!), DataFlow has been tweaked, refined, and generally made even more awesome to handle all your import and export needs with the grace of a caffeinated unicorn.
Whether you’re migrating content, updating product catalogs, or just trying to make sense of your data mountain, DataFlow is here to help. Say goodbye to manual data entry and hello to streamlined, efficient workflows that will free up your time for more important things – like arguing about tabs versus spaces or finally finishing that side project you’ve been putting off. So, buckle up, grab your favorite beverage, and let’s dive into how DataFlow CSV Import / Export can revolutionize the way you manage data on your site. Get ready to import, export, and conquer!
Diving Deep: Key Features of DataFlow
Alright, let’s get into the juicy bits of DataFlow. First, Comprehensive Data Support. We’re not just talking posts and pages here. Oh no. We’re talking everything: posts, pages, custom post types, users, and even those ridiculously complex custom fields you thought you’d never wrangle. Consider it tamed.
Next up, Flexible Mapping. Forget rigid structures! This feature lets you connect CSV columns to the right fields with ease. It’s practically psychic! If you mess it up, don’t blame us. That’s on you.
Then there’s Scheduled Imports/Exports. Automate everything. Set it and forget it. No more manual data entry drudgery. DataFlow handles the heavy lifting, ensuring data consistency without you lifting a finger (except to set the schedule, of course).
What about those monstrously large CSV files? No sweat! Our Large File Handling is so efficient; it laughs in the face of gigabytes. No performance compromises, promise! And for when you inevitably mess things up, we’ve got Rollback Functionality. Undo imports like they never happened. It’s like having a time machine for your data. Finally, Customizable Delimiters offer supreme flexibility. Use commas, semicolons, or even emojis (kidding… mostly). It supports all sorts of CSV formats so you can import how you want.
Why DataFlow is a Game Changer: Benefits Unveiled
So, you’re still manually entering data? Bless your heart. Let’s talk about how DataFlow CSV Import / Export can rescue you from that special kind of torment. Imagine all the extra coffee breaks when you ditch manual data entry. That’s time savings, my friend.
Ever copy-pasted something and realized later it was horribly wrong? DataFlow's mapping and validation are like having eagle eyes on your data, slashing errors. *Accuracy* is no longer a happy accident.
Forget babysitting imports. Schedule them! Handle those gigantic CSV files without your site collapsing. This isn't just efficient; it's *enhanced efficiency*. Think of it as giving your server a superhero upgrade.
Tired of data looking like it was translated by a confused pigeon? DataFlow keeps everything *consistent*. No more spreadsheets arguing over what a 'date' actually means.
Worried about complexity? Don't be! The interface is so easy, even your least tech-savvy team member can use it. Well, maybe. We're not making promises about *everyone*.
Finally, the big one: *cost-effectiveness*. Less time wasted, fewer errors to fix – it all adds up. Think of the money you'll save! You might even afford that solid gold stapler you've always wanted. (Okay, maybe not, but you *will* save money.)
DataFlow vs. the World: Standing Out from the Crowd
So, you’re looking at CSV import/export plugins, eh? Smart move! But why choose DataFlow? Let’s be frank: we owe a debt to the groundwork laid by earlier solutions, specifically the original work from AitThemes.Club. We took that spark of genius and cranked it up to eleven. We’ve optimized the core, boosting processing speed and stability. Forget waiting ages for large files!
What makes us really special? While some plugins offer basic import/export, DataFlow emphasizes a streamlined user experience. We believe data wrangling shouldn’t feel like pulling teeth. Our interface is clean, intuitive, and dare we say, even enjoyable.
Furthermore, DataFlow boasts extensive customization options. Need to tweak how dates are formatted? No problem. Want to remap specific fields on the fly? Easy peasy. Our flexibility adapts to your workflow. We’re also building a strong community. Your feedback shapes our updates. Finally, let’s talk cost. We provide exceptional value. You get premium features without the premium price tag. DataFlow: the smart choice for serious data handling.
Getting Started: A Step-by-Step Guide to Importing and Exporting
Let’s dive into using DataFlow! You’ve already installed the plugin. Now, navigate to the settings panel. Here, you’ll configure general options like date formats and field delimiters. These settings are crucial for ensuring data is interpreted correctly. Remember, DataFlow is inspired by AIT CSV Import / Export, but we’ve focused on speed and user experience.
Importing Data:
- Go to the ‘Import’ section. Upload your CSV file.
- The plugin will analyze the file. Map each column to the corresponding data field. This is drag and drop and intuitive.
- Handle errors proactively. Define what should happen with empty fields or incorrect data. Should the process stop, skip or continue?
- Start the import process.
Exporting Data:
- Head to the ‘Export’ area. Choose what data you want to export.
- Select your export options. You can select specific data or all data.
- Configure the CSV format. Choose delimiters and file encoding.
- Start the export. Download your CSV file.
Troubleshooting:
- File Format Errors: Ensure your CSV is correctly formatted and uses the specified delimiter.
- Mapping Problems: Double-check that all columns are correctly mapped.
- Import Failures: Check the error logs for detailed information.
Advanced Tips: For large datasets, increase the memory limit in your configuration file. DataFlow is optimized for performance.
Level Up: Advanced Techniques and Customizations
Ready to take your data handling to the next level? This chapter dives into advanced techniques. Custom fields can be managed by defining specific mapping rules within the plugin settings. Employ conditional logic during imports by using the plugin’s built-in features or by leveraging custom code to evaluate data and determine import actions based on predefined conditions. Data validation is crucial. Implement rules using regular expressions or custom functions. These checks ensure data integrity before importing or exporting.
Hooks and filters are your gateway to extending the plugin’s core functionality. Utilize these to modify data on the fly or add custom processing steps. For large datasets, optimize performance by increasing memory limits and batch processing. Consider using direct database connections for faster speeds, if available. Explore the plugin’s API for integration with other services. This enables automated data synchronization and enhances your workflow. Remember to consult the plugin documentation for specific API endpoints and usage examples.
Final words
So, there you have it, folks! DataFlow CSV Import / Export is more than just a plugin; it’s your trusty sidekick in the never-ending battle against data chaos. From its humble beginnings as a fork of the stellar AIT CSV Import / Export, it’s evolved into a powerhouse of efficiency and ease. Whether you’re a seasoned developer, a busy agency, or an open-source enthusiast, DataFlow is designed to make your life easier, one CSV file at a time.
With its comprehensive feature set, including flexible mapping, scheduled tasks, and large file handling, DataFlow takes the pain out of data management. Say goodbye to tedious manual entry and hello to streamlined workflows that free up your time for the things you actually enjoy – like perfecting your coffee brewing technique or binge-watching your favorite shows. And with its intuitive interface and customizable options, DataFlow is accessible to users of all skill levels.
But don’t just take our word for it. Give DataFlow CSV Import / Export a try and experience the difference for yourself. Available now, exclusively on Festinger Vault, this plugin is a game-changer for anyone looking to simplify their data management processes. So, go ahead, import, export, and conquer – your data will thank you for it! Ready to transform your workflow?
Latest changelog
**Version 3.0.4** - Added: Support for custom post type relationships during import. - Improved: Enhanced error logging for easier troubleshooting. - Fixed: Resolved an issue with date formatting during export. - Security: Implemented additional security measures to prevent unauthorized data access. - Updated: Compatibility with the latest version of the core software. - Optimized: Performance improvements for large CSV files. - Fixed: Issue with importing special characters. - Added: Option to skip specific columns during import. - Improved: User interface enhancements for better usability. - Fixed: Bug that caused incorrect data mapping in certain scenarios.
Changelog
Demo Content
Comments
About
- 3.0.4
- 26 seconds ago
- May 15, 2025
- AitThemes.Club™
- View all from author
-
- Silver Access
- Data Management
- GPL v2 or later
- Support Link